npm-package-downloads
1.2.0 • Public • Published npm-package-downloads
fetch packages download counts.
Install
$ npm i npm-package-downloads --save
Usage
npmPackageDownloads(pkgName(s), period)
- pkgName
{String|Array(String)}
: pkg name or array of pkgs name. eg: 'express', ['express', 'koa']
- period
{String}
:
- semantic: 'last-day', 'last-week', 'last-month'
- specific date: '2016-01-01'
- specific range: '2016-01-01:2016-01-31'
Example
'use strict';
var npmPackageDownloads = require('npm-package-downloads');
npmPackageDownloads('').catch(function (error) {
console.log(error.message);
});
npmPackageDownloads('express', 'last-month').then(function (res) {
console.log(res);
});
npmPackageDownloads([
'express',
'ahudsfgikaj',
'@shimo/gulp-build',
'@shimo/gulp-buildhaha'
], '2016-01-01:2016-01-31').then(function (res) {
console.log(res);
});
License
MIT
/npm-package-downloads/
//
Package Sidebar
Install
npm i npm-package-downloads
Weekly Downloads